C# Class Device, Hero.Coli

Afficher le fichier Open project: CyberCRI/Hero.Coli Class Usage Examples

Méthodes publiques

Méthode Description
Equals ( System obj ) : bool
ToString ( ) : string
buildDevice ( Device, device ) : Device,
buildDevice ( ExpressionModule, em ) : Device,
buildDevice ( LinkedList bricks ) : Device,
buildDevice ( LinkedList modules ) : Device,
buildDevice ( string name, LinkedList modules ) : Device,
buildDevice ( string name, float beta, string formula, float rbsFactor, string proteinName, float terminatorFactor ) : Device,
getExpressionLevel ( ) : float
getExpressionModules ( ) : LinkedList
getFirstGeneProteinName ( ) : string
getInternalName ( ) : string
getReactions ( ) : LinkedList
getSize ( ) : int
hasSameBricks ( Device, device ) : bool

Private Methods

Méthode Description
Device ( string name, LinkedList modules ) : System
generateInternalName ( ) : string
generateInternalName ( LinkedList modules ) : string
getProductsFromBiobricks ( LinkedList list ) : LinkedList
getPromoterReaction ( ExpressionModule, em, int id ) : PromoterProperties,
getPromoterReactions ( ) : LinkedList
idInit ( ) : void
isValid ( LinkedList modules ) : bool

Method Details

Equals() public méthode

public Equals ( System obj ) : bool
obj System
Résultat bool

ToString() public méthode

public ToString ( ) : string
Résultat string

buildDevice() public static méthode

public static buildDevice ( Device, device ) : Device,
device Device,
Résultat Device,

buildDevice() public static méthode

public static buildDevice ( ExpressionModule, em ) : Device,
em ExpressionModule,
Résultat Device,

buildDevice() public static méthode

public static buildDevice ( LinkedList bricks ) : Device,
bricks LinkedList
Résultat Device,

buildDevice() public static méthode

public static buildDevice ( LinkedList modules ) : Device,
modules LinkedList
Résultat Device,

buildDevice() public static méthode

public static buildDevice ( string name, LinkedList modules ) : Device,
name string
modules LinkedList
Résultat Device,

buildDevice() public static méthode

public static buildDevice ( string name, float beta, string formula, float rbsFactor, string proteinName, float terminatorFactor ) : Device,
name string
beta float
formula string
rbsFactor float
proteinName string
terminatorFactor float
Résultat Device,

getExpressionLevel() public méthode

public getExpressionLevel ( ) : float
Résultat float

getExpressionModules() public méthode

public getExpressionModules ( ) : LinkedList
Résultat LinkedList

getFirstGeneProteinName() public méthode

public getFirstGeneProteinName ( ) : string
Résultat string

getInternalName() public méthode

public getInternalName ( ) : string
Résultat string

getReactions() public méthode

public getReactions ( ) : LinkedList
Résultat LinkedList

getSize() public méthode

public getSize ( ) : int
Résultat int

hasSameBricks() public méthode

public hasSameBricks ( Device, device ) : bool
device Device,
Résultat bool